July 2013 Elastic Offloading by Dale Denis. Dale Denis The Elastic Offloading of Computationally Intensive Tasks to the Cloud to Augment the Computing.

Slides:



Advertisements
Similar presentations
IBM Software Group ® Integrated Server and Virtual Storage Management an IT Optimization Infrastructure Solution from IBM Small and Medium Business Software.
Advertisements

The case for VM based Cloudlets in Mobile Computing
ECOS: Leveraging Software-Defined Networks to Support Mobile Application Offloading Aaron Gember, Christopher Dragga, Aditya Akella University of Wisconsin-Madison.
Click Here to Begin. Objectives Purchasing a PC can be a difficult process full of complex questions. This Computer Based Training Module will walk you.
CLOUD COMPUTING FOR MOBILE USERS: CAN OFFLOADING COMPUTATION SAVE ENERGY? Purdue University.
1 Distributed Systems Meet Economics: Pricing in Cloud Computing Hadi Salimi Distributed Systems Lab, School of Computer Engineering, Iran University of.
Autonomous Agents-based Mobile-Cloud Computing. Mobile-Cloud Computing (MCC) MCC refers to an infrastructure where the data storage and data processing.
Gueyoung Jung, Nathan Gnanasambandam, and Tridib Mukherjee International Conference on Cloud Computing 2012.
Tablet Shootout Presented By: Garrett Bahr, Austin Schwai, Travis Tilot.
Cloud Based Framework for Rich Mobile Application Roberto Fonseca, Andrew Williams and Krishna Sharma Project Champion: Reza Rahimi.
Who Wants An A?. What name is used for the area of a computer that temporarily holds data waiting to be processed, stored, or output? A.Hard Drive B.Random.
Properties Change theme Properties Change theme Windows (standard) Windows start.
Introduction to Android Platform Overview
Device 1Device 2Device 3 Display, inch (cm) Resolution, pixels 1136x x 1080 Weight, gr Processor Dual core, 1,4 GHz Quad core, 2.5GHz Quad core,

Lesson Objectives To understand the difference between RAM and ROM
CloudMoV: Cloud-based Mobile Social TV
LAPTOP SELECTION Using Value Engineering By Mazen A. Al-Juaid August 13, 2005 CEM 512 Value Engineering.
CS 153 Design of Operating Systems Spring 2015 Lecture 24: Android OS.
Buying a Laptop. 3 Main Components The 3 main components to consider when buying a laptop or computer are Processor – The Bigger the Ghz the faster the.
Motivation “Every three minutes a woman is diagnosed with Breast cancer” (American Cancer Society, “Detailed Guide: Breast Cancer,” 2006) Explore the use.
Energy Issues in Data Analytics Domenico Talia Carmela Comito Università della Calabria & CNR-ICAR Italy
Comp-TIA Standards.  AMD- (Advanced Micro Devices) An American multinational semiconductor company that develops computer processors and related technologies.
HARDWARE Lesson 2. Components of a computer: 1)A Processor (or CPU) The brain of the computer 2)Memory To remember the programs and data that it uses.
A Survey of Mobile Cloud Computing Application Models
Different CPUs CLICK THE SPINNING COMPUTER TO MOVE ON.
Communications. How do computers work?  Computer is made up of many different parts  Receives input from user  Processes information  Produces an.
Software Engineering for Business Information Systems (sebis) Department of Informatics Technische Universität München, Germany wwwmatthes.in.tum.de Data-Parallel.
BestPeer++: A Peer-to-Peer Based Large-Scale Data Processing Platform.
PACK: Prediction-Based Cloud Bandwidth and Cost Reduction System
Module 1: Installing and Configuring Servers. Module Overview Installing Windows Server 2008 Managing Server Roles and Features Overview of the Server.
Power Point created by Jeff Brislane.  After some feedback from the employer we done some research and from that research we have some recommendations.
Printed by Web Browser Comparison By: Gustavo Marrero & Ignacio Pérez Universidad Interamericana de Puerto Rico   In our experiment.
Presented by: Mostafa Magdi. Contents Introduction. Cloud Computing Definition. Cloud Computing Characteristics. Cloud Computing Key features. Cost Virtualization.
Brands of computers Dell Apple Gateway HP Acer Toshiba IBM Lenovo Fujitsu Asus Samsung Amazon Kindle Chrome Book.
© CCI Learning Solutions Inc. 1 Lesson 2: Elements of a Personal Computer System unit Microprocessor chip How memory is measured What ROM is What RAM is.
Agenda Master Expert Associat e Microsoft Certified Solutions Master (MCSM) Microsoft Certified Solutions Expert (MCSE) Microsoft Certified Solutions.
Orchestrator 2012 The Unknown Hero of Automation David Norling-Christensen Senior Systems Architect.
CSE 451: Operating Systems Spring 2013 Module 26 Cloud Computing Ed Lazowska Allen Center 570 © 2013 Gribble, Lazowska, Levy,
Operating System Provides a set of services to system users Manages memory (primary and secondary) and I/O devices Exploits the hardware resources of one.
What’s new. Flavors of Vista Windows Vista Home Basic Windows Vista Home Premium Windows Vista Business Windows Vista Enterprise Windows Vista Ultimate.
Cloud Computing Ed Lazowska Bill & Melinda Gates Chair in Computer Science & Engineering University of Washington.
CSE 451: Operating Systems Autumn 2010 Module 25 Cloud Computing Ed Lazowska Allen Center 570.
How are they called?.
Cloud Computing is a Nebulous Subject Or how I learned to love VDF on Amazon.
Unit 7 PC SYSTEMS Unit 7: PC Systems Unit type: Certificate and Diploma Learning hours: 60 hours Unit level: 1.
Operating Systems. Categories of Software System Software –Operating Systems (OS) –Language Translators –Utility Programs Application Software.
FEASIBILITY REPORT ON TABLET BRANDS BY ZACHARY CORLEY, CALEB ELSON, AND BIANCA LAWRENCE.
Computer Performance. Hard Drive - HDD Stores your files, programs, and information. If it gets full, you can’t save any more. Measured in bytes (KB,
Energy-efficient Scheduling policy for collaborative execution in mobile cloud computing INFOCOM '13.
Dynamic Mobile Cloud Computing: Ad Hoc and Opportunistic Job Sharing.
Mobile Graphics – EG 2017 Tutorial
PC Components Microprocessor - performs all computations RAM - larger RAM memory contains more data Motherboard - holds all the above components Ports.
IPad2 vs. Galaxy Tablet 10.1 Patrick Valenti.
Classifying & evaluating computers
Computer Systems Nat 4/5 Computing Science
Computer Systems Nat 4/5 Computing Science
Installation 1. Installation Sources
Introduction | Model | Solution | Evaluation
Realizing the potential of mobile devices as experimental devices: Human computer interface and performance considerations Chiung Ching Ho & C. Eswaran.
Evolution of the mobile graphics world
Swipe 3G Mobile with Gorilla Glass Experience the Difference!
Best Touchscreen Laptop Rental in Dubai
EC2 – Selecting the right instance type for your workload
Software & hardware interaction
GRAPHIC ALARM MANAGEMENT SYSTEM
Intel Core 2 Duo Processor T5750
The best phone to buy.
Aadhar Enabled Biometric Attendance System
Ultra Low Networking Latency
Presentation transcript:

July 2013 Elastic Offloading by Dale Denis

Dale Denis The Elastic Offloading of Computationally Intensive Tasks to the Cloud to Augment the Computing Capabilities of a Mobile Device.

Dale Denis The Environment Samsung ATIV S Windows Phone 8 Dual Core 1.5 GHz processor 1024 MB RAM Amazon’s EC2 M1 Large 2 Cores 7.5 GB RAM

Dale Denis The Application

Dale Denis Offloading Decision Criteria Elapsed time Maximum battery discharge time Maximum memory utilization

Dale Denis Evaluation

Dale Denis Evaluation

Dale Denis Evaluation

Dale Denis Lessons Learned A.Significant gains can be realized through the elastic offloading of computationally intensive operations to the cloud. B.Offloading solutions must consider the unique nature of mobile devices. C. Offloading decision engines must consider: 1.Execution time 2.System resources 3.Monetary costs 4.User preferences